Ecumenical patriarchate rejects Filaret's complaints

CONSTANTINOPLE PATRIARCHATE REACTS NEGATIVELY TO PATRIARCH FILARET'S STATEMENTS

Credo.Press, 15 May 2019

 

The ecumenical patriarchate commented on statements by Honorary Patriarch Filaret of the Orthodox Church of Ukraine (PTsU), which he made at a press conference in Kiev on 15 May. "Only a lie," BBC quotes the response of its source within the patriarchate.

 

"As Ecumenical Patriarch Bartholomew said, there is no patriarch in Kiev, because there never was a patriarch. Filaret is the former metropolitan of Kiev," the source noted.

 

At his press conference, Filaret declared that the primate of the PTsU, Metropolitan Epifany, violated agreements that had been reached within the context of the unification council on 15 December 2018, and therefore a dual-power arose, but such a situation can be fixed. In Filaret's opinion, he should be administering the PTsU within Ukraine and not Epifany. (tr. by PDS, posted 15 May 2019)
